Generally, check for visual damage or cover-ups due to some hidden past. Check thoroughly and take your time. If the seller got nothing to hide then he won't be afraid that you check carefully. Check for signs of wear and tear and also rust on parts like forks. Check the electronics to ensure that its working good also. IF you are unsure, ask someone experienced to go along with you.

free the bike from stand, hands on the handle compress the front fork repeatedly... it should compress and rebound freely, same goes to the rear as well. Check for leak, damages & loose fastener. Triple clamp should turn freely, free the front wheel from ground you should not experience binding, vertical movement and uneven movement from the handlebar.
Free the rear from the ground, grab hold of the swingarm & try moving it side to side... this would verify the swingarm bearing

I think there is one hundred and one things to check. Bring someone experience. Yes.
Usually, interior can't check much.
To me, if a 2nd hand bike... can't expect much.
1) tyres... threading?
2) exterior body crack?
3) Meters
4) chain... loose? extended all the way? stil loose? ( old chain)
5) suspension, ( as mentioned by mild slevin) (Fork is expensive to fix if spoil)
6) start engine.. listen to engine, any funny noise (exhuast got modified before..)
7) check below the engine is there is leaking of black oil or something. (sealing, or gasket need to replace)
8) brake pads wearing out? push it forward n back wards.. hear got any funny noise?(worn out brake pads)
9) braking disc, any scratches ( brake disc oso not cheap to replace)
10) check the the headlight...when openingthe throttle, doesnt the headlight become brighter? If it doesnt, most probably is the batt , alternator, rectifier got problem.
